**First-day checklist — Item 4: Reception relocation.** The Hollowbrook Partners reception desk now operates from the ground floor atrium, not Level 2, following the autumn refit. Confirm the new starter knows to report there, verify their name against the arrivals list from People Operations, and issue the day-one lanyard. When escorting them through the inner turnstiles, use the temporary pass code below.

badge for fafop-fajof: bdg-Z-47

## SockPress Env Vars

SockPress toggles websocket compression per connection. `SP_COMPRESS_LEVEL` trades CPU for bandwidth; levels above 6 rarely help on Varnmouth traffic and inflate latency. Reviewers should confirm the level matches the load-test baseline. The compression stats exporter authenticates to our metrics hub, and its credential appears on the next line.

sealed setting: RELAY_SECRET5=82864

Subject: DR Drill Friday — Veritas-Frame validator plugins

Team,

This Friday we run the disaster-recovery drill for the Veritas-Frame validation platform. During the drill, third-party validator plugins will be disabled, so expect support tickets about "missing rules" — reassure customers this is planned. To restore the plugin registry afterward, one of you must unlock the cold-standby registry node from the support console. The recovery passphrase for that unlock step is provided below.

strongbox words: zorwyn-sorael-belion-ulaius-silmir-ulays-briax-rusdor-gorix

## Authentication

The Gloverpane audit-log viewer won't show you anything until you authenticate against the internal Ledgerhut API. Support reps get a shared read-only credential — don't use your personal login, it'll just 403. Pop the key into the AUTH header on every request. Here's the current shared key.

app token of yajeg-kawef = kto11_7En3XSX8xQw